Medical Superabsorbent Polymers: Hospitals Contribute Significantly to Demand as Medical Waste Management Gains Higher Emphasis
End-use of medical superabsorbent polymers continues to remain high in hospitals. Operation theatres (OTs) form an integral part of hospitals, wherein the consistent flow of patients entail the requirement for a wide range of surgical procedures. This makes it imperative for hospitals to keep their OTs clean and hygienic. Minimizing the clean-up time prevails as a major concern among hospitals worldwide. Time-effective and safe management & disposition of suction canister waste is a primary task linked with surgery clean-ups.

Traditional suction canister solidifier take over 30 minutes for proper handling and disposing of waste. New technologies are therefore being developed using superabsorbent polymers, which remarkably trim the time taken for complete solidification and disposal of liquid medical waste. These technologies are demonstrating high penetration into hospitals worldwide, thereby complementing their dominance in the medical superabsorbent polymers market.
Superabsorbent Spacer Fabrics Development for Exuding Wound Dressing Application
Exuding wound care entails the need for dressing that quickly absorb exudates, and exert effective moisture management during the healing of wounds. Currently available commercial wound dressings are linked with a slew of limitations such as low-absorbency and high evaporation. In addition, non-occlusive nature of these wound dressings, and the requirement for secondary dressing for retaining a moist environment on the surface of wound, have further confined their performance and effectiveness.
Recognizing the concern, manufacturers have been inclining their preference toward spacer fabrics for use as absorbent medical products. Recent research efforts have given birth to superabsorbent spacer fabrics for application in exuding wound care. The three-layered structure of these fabrics deliver faster wetting speed and twice the absorbency compared to foam dressings. Additionally, air permeability of superabsorbent spacer fabrics is relatively higher, making them suitable for applications in exuding wound dressings.
